WebFeb 13, 2024 · Sleep Sacks vs. Swaddles – The Difference. The most obvious difference is that a swaddle is a blanket meant to entirely wrap the baby and restrict the movement of the arms and legs, while a sleep sack goes beyond a simple blanket.
